To improve indoor air quality, use vacuums that utilize HEPA filters that remove dust particles, allergens, and pathogens, and assess whether the chemicals you are using to clean and disinfect are free of fragrances, preservatives, and other additives that may irritate employees or guests. ✅ ✅ Allergen. Learn2Serve specializes in online courses – the goal is to help you complete your certification entirely online. In fact, Learn2Serve is the only ANSI-recognized Certified Food Protection Manager (CFPM) program that allows online proctoring for your final certification exam. Course Type.
